Pikachu Value Breakdown
As of 2026, Pikachu (Power Keepers, 57/108) is worth around $33.77 in Near Mint condition. Condition drives the price hard: a Near Mint copy is worth about $33.77, while a Damaged one drops to roughly $15.34. The full condition ladder runs Near Mint $33.77, Lightly Played $32.25, Moderately Played $23.60, Heavily Played $23.71, Damaged $15.34 — so grading the condition correctly before you buy or sell matters more than almost anything else. A PSA 10 (Gem Mint) example is valued near $2,170 — about 64x the raw price, which is the single biggest swing in this card's value. PSA 9 copies sit around $217.50.
Is It Worth Grading Pikachu?
Grading Pikachu can pay off concretely: the gap between its raw value ($33.77) and a PSA 10 ($2,170) is about $2,136 — a 64x uplift before grading fees. Other graded tiers we track: PSA 9 $217.50, BGS 9.5 $250.00, PSA 8 $85.00. Grading is worth considering if your copy looks clean — the PSA 10 premium can comfortably clear the fee.
